Thanks for your inquiry. The front bracket was sitting with one end in the lower seat position and one end in the higher one which I inadvertently missed when taking the picture. The seat posts are held in firmly by rubber straps and work properly. I don't know the size for which the Russell Day Long seat was built for, however, I am 5'11", 220lbs, with a 32" inseam. The seat does sit a bit higher than stock but causes me no issues with foot placement. I can't flat foot it with both feet, but can stand steadily with both feet on the balls of them. The padding is judicious and is very comfortable for "day long" rides. I got it to replace a Sargent that I had for years but was no longer comfortable, and was very happy with the result. The Corbin seat I have listed is also much more comfortable than the Sargent and does sit lower than the RDL.
